Regular Expresion

Tags:    php

Jeg vil gerne benytte regular expresion til at finde dele af html koden, eller retere omskrive dele af html koden.

hvis jeg har f.esk
<img src="sti/pigc.jpg">

skal den blive til

<img src="$pagez/sti/pigc.jpg">

jeg har pøvet med <img src="*">
og med [<img src="]*[>]

som filter men det virker ikke.

nogen som kan hjælpe mig med det???

mvh.
Thomas Crhistensen
-------------------------------------------------------
Visual Basic noget for dig?
tjek Visual Basic-Gruppen
http://www.udvikleren.dk/groups/?gid=41



6 svar postet i denne tråd vises herunder
1 indlæg har modtaget i alt 2 karma
Sorter efter stemmer Sorter efter dato

Kan se at den forrige metode jeg skriv ikke er så sikker... Det er den her:

Fold kodeboks ind/udKode 


Den udskifter kun img tags, og ikke script tags etc!

MH.

The-Freak

Livet er for kort til at kede sig.


Hmm.... Det var også forkert :S... Her er den rigtige:
Fold kodeboks ind/udKode 


Før stod der $pagez i selve src, når den blev outputtet til browseren :P... Det er fixet med den der :P

MH.

The-Freak

Livet er for kort til at kede sig.



echo '<img src="'.$side.'/hej/noget.fil">';

prøv det :P

- php-4ever

[Redigeret d. 15/10-04 11:08:54 af php-4ever]



echo '<img src="'.$side.'/hej/noget.fil">';

prøv det :P

- php-4ever

[Redigeret d. 15/10-04 11:08:54 af php-4ever]


Problemet er at jeg ikke ved hvilke linie elelr hvor i filen det står, eller hvilket sti der står bagefter, jeg vil lave et slags script der sætter en $side foran skråstregen i et img tag

-Tc
-------------------------------------------------------
Visual Basic noget for dig?
tjek Visual Basic-Gruppen
http://www.udvikleren.dk/groups/?gid=41




Sådan her kan det gøres(Antager at det du vil replace ligger i $replacestr).:

Fold kodeboks ind/udKode 


$replacestr vil så have fået udskiftet alle forkomster af src="*" skiftet ud med src="$pages/*"(Hvor * i den nye svare til * i den gamle!)...

MH.

The-Freak

Livet er for kort til at kede sig.




Kan se at den forrige metode jeg skriv ikke er så sikker... Det er den her:

Fold kodeboks ind/udKode 


Den udskifter kun img tags, og ikke script tags etc!

MH.

The-Freak

Livet er for kort til at kede sig.




Kan se at den forrige metode jeg skriv ikke er så sikker... Det er den her:

Fold kodeboks ind/udKode 


Den udskifter kun img tags, og ikke script tags etc!

MH.

The-Freak

Livet er for kort til at kede sig.

Hmm.... Det var også forkert :S... Her er den rigtige:
Fold kodeboks ind/udKode 


Før stod der $pagez i selve src, når den blev outputtet til browseren :P... Det er fixet med den der :P

MH.

The-Freak

Livet er for kort til at kede sig.


Jeps det fantd jeg ud af :)
Mange tak skal ud have :)

mvh.
Thomas Christensen
-------------------------------------------------------
Visual Basic noget for dig?
tjek Visual Basic-Gruppen
http://www.udvikleren.dk/groups/?gid=41



t